After one night on Stapper we packed our stuff again to get on the way. Unfortunately we discovered that Yakamoz had developed allergies for mosquito bites. Thats not good news for our trip since there are mosquitos everywhere. So after a quick visit to the pharmacy for allergy pills we took a train back to Hengelo for the passport. We had to walk so many hours in the burning sun with our backpacks to the gasstation. A couple took us from there but they realised that they were on the wrong way so they dropped us in Melle, in a gasstation on the wrong side of the road we later realized. We had to hitch a ride to the wrong direction to the north of Osnabruck where we could cross the highway over a bridge. By then it was already late in the evening and we had given up hope of getting very far that day. Shortly after we got a nice ride with a very funny guy who entertained us for an hour or so till Dusseldorf, where we decided to call it a day. Luckily there was a gap in the fence of the gas station so that we could camp in the forest next to it. It was an exhausting day, but we ended up sleeping in a magical place surrounded by fireflies.
